Fico's Coalition Wants to Abolish the Postal Vote From Abroad. It Is the Weakest in It

The Slovak government coalition led by the Směr party is preparing to abolish the possibility of postal voting for Slovaks living abroad. The information was confirmed by Erik Kaliňák, chairman of the Board of Advisors to Prime Minister Robert Fico. According to him, voting should now only be held in person at Slovak embassies.
